This thesis will try and focus on comparing Procedural programming with Object oriented programming. It shows the comparison of PP and OOP via statistics. It compared PP and OOP via application tests, speed and performance. This was done by comparing the speed of both programming languages to run a similar example. The difference between C Struct and C++ classes was also taken into consideration. In order to illustrate different aspects and use cases of PP and OOP, C and C++ programming languages will be used respectively. Several examples have been used throughout the thesis for comparing PP and OOP. As a result of given research, the importance and usability of PP and OOP was realized. It became obvious that PP is not an "old" paradig...
Initially, object-orientation and parallelism originated and developed as separate and relatively in...
Object oriented paradigm is the most popular programming paradigm for large scale applications. Most...
Abstract: Programming education has experienced a shift from imperative and procedural programming t...
The concepts of structured and object-oriented programming methods are not relatively new but these ...
This document describes the main features of Object Oriented Programming (OOP). The C++ programming ...
M.Sc. (Computer Science)This report is primarily concerned with highlighting fmdings of a research r...
Applications, and their associated programming models, have had a profound influence on computer arc...
Object-oriented programming has become a widely-used, important programming paradigm that is support...
Object-oriented programming (OOP) is a technique for improving productivity, quality, and innovation...
We begin by introducing a short history of types of programming languages. Object-oriented programmi...
Object-oriented Programming (hereinafter referred to as OOP0 is becoming very important in the data ...
This paper presents the Parallel Programming Languages and its Comparison of C and C++ programming L...
Abstract. The understanding of programming paradigms has not been fully established yet, though many...
The paper presents an approach to introduction to Object-Oriented Programming (OOP) on the basis of ...
Object-oriented programming is a popular buzzword these days. What is the reason for this popularity...
Initially, object-orientation and parallelism originated and developed as separate and relatively in...
Object oriented paradigm is the most popular programming paradigm for large scale applications. Most...
Abstract: Programming education has experienced a shift from imperative and procedural programming t...
The concepts of structured and object-oriented programming methods are not relatively new but these ...
This document describes the main features of Object Oriented Programming (OOP). The C++ programming ...
M.Sc. (Computer Science)This report is primarily concerned with highlighting fmdings of a research r...
Applications, and their associated programming models, have had a profound influence on computer arc...
Object-oriented programming has become a widely-used, important programming paradigm that is support...
Object-oriented programming (OOP) is a technique for improving productivity, quality, and innovation...
We begin by introducing a short history of types of programming languages. Object-oriented programmi...
Object-oriented Programming (hereinafter referred to as OOP0 is becoming very important in the data ...
This paper presents the Parallel Programming Languages and its Comparison of C and C++ programming L...
Abstract. The understanding of programming paradigms has not been fully established yet, though many...
The paper presents an approach to introduction to Object-Oriented Programming (OOP) on the basis of ...
Object-oriented programming is a popular buzzword these days. What is the reason for this popularity...
Initially, object-orientation and parallelism originated and developed as separate and relatively in...
Object oriented paradigm is the most popular programming paradigm for large scale applications. Most...
Abstract: Programming education has experienced a shift from imperative and procedural programming t...